Full Job Description
Job Overview:

We are seeking an experienced and safety-driven General Foreman to oversee underground gas distribution construction operations. This role is responsible for managing multiple crews, coordinating field activities, ensuring compliance with safety and quality standards, and delivering projects on schedule and within budget. The ideal candidate has strong leadership skills, extensive underground utility experience, and a deep understanding of gas distribution systems.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Supervise and coordinate daily activities of underground gas distribution crews and subcontractors
  • Oversee installation, maintenance, repair, and replacement of underground gas mains and services
  • Ensure all work is performed safely and in compliance with OSHA, company policies, and local/state regulations
  • Conduct daily job site safety meetings and enforce safe work practices
  • Plan manpower, equipment, and material needs for assigned projects
  • Monitor production schedules and project progress to meet deadlines and budgets
  • Read and interpret utility plans, blueprints, and specifications
  • Coordinate with project managers, inspectors, municipalities, and utility representatives
  • Maintain accurate project documentation, reports, and timesheets
  • Train, mentor, and develop field personnel and foremen
  • Identify and resolve field issues proactively to minimize delays and operational disruptions
  • Ensure proper restoration and cleanup of work sites


Qualifications:
  • Minimum 5+ years of experience in underground gas distribution construction
  • Strong knowledge of underground utility installation methods, gas distribution systems, and pipeline safety practices
  • Ability to lead multiple crews in a fast-paced construction environment
  • Experience with excavation, trenching, shoring, and heavy equipment operations
  • Working knowledge of OSHA regulations and utility industry standards
  • Strong communication, organizational, and problem-solving skills
  • Valid driver's license with clean driving record
  • Ability to work outdoors in varied weather conditions and travel to job sites as needed
